Waltz for Debby was written by American jazz pianist and composer Bill Evans (1929-1980). It was heard for the first time on his 1956 debut record New Jazz Conceptions.
This recording made the tune his most famous one, included on several later recordings both for solo piano and his usual trio format. It also became a favorite on almost all his concerts.
The tune is a kind of a musical portrait of Evans' niece, Debby Evans.
In Scandinavia, Swedish singer Monica Zetterlund made it popular for a wider audience through her 1964-recording accompanied by Evans and his trio. On this recording, the song was renamed Monicas vals.
